Acaraú has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 79°F (26°C). Winters average 78°F in January while summers reach 80°F in July / relatively mild seasonal variation. The area gets 344 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 53.4 inches (wetter than the 38-inch national average). The city sits at an elevation of 56 feet.

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 78°F (26°C) | 3.7 in | Coldest |
| February | 82°F (28°C) | 7.3 in | |
| March | 81°F (27°C) | 13.0 in | Wettest |
| April | 81°F (27°C) | 12.5 in | |
| May | 80°F (27°C) | 7.4 in | |
| June | 80°F (27°C) | 2.4 in | |
| July | 80°F (27°C) | 1.2 in | |
| August | 81°F (27°C) | 0.1 in | |
| September | 82°F (28°C) | 0.1 in | |
| October | 83°F (28°C) | 0.1 in | Driest |
| November | 83°F (28°C) | 0.2 in | Warmest |
| December | 83°F (28°C) | 1.1 in |
Acaraú has a seasonal temperature swing of 5°F / from 78°F in January to 83°F in November. Total annual precipitation is 49.1 inches, with March being the wettest month (13.0") and October the driest (0.1").
